Subaru Forester: Continuously variable transmission / Selection of “L” (if equipped)

Type A

Type B
“L” is for using engine braking when going
down a hill, etc. To select this mode, move
the select lever from the “D” position to the
“L” position.

Type A

Type B
When selected, the indicator “L” will
illuminate on the combination meter.
To deselect “L”, move the select lever to
the “D” position.
